Pulled the defective damper this afternoon and it is in fact blown. Had no problem compressing it by hand after pulling it out. Never thought to check this before installing. At least everyone involved is trying to expedite getting this resolved asap. Shipping it out to MCS tomorrow.
Weather finally cleared out and I took the car for a test drive. Didn't make it 10 feet without a problem, passenger side rear strut is defective/blown. Just my luck.

MCS 2wnr coilovers showed up this week. Went with divorced rears to avoid swaybar clearance issues.
